Kadioglu, Cansel; Uzuntiryaki-Kondakci, Esen – Eurasian Journal of Educational Research, 2014
Problem Statement: Motivation plays an important role in explaining students' academic achievement. In an effort to explain students' purposes for learning and the reasons they engage in a learning activity, different achievement goal models (dichotomous, trichotomous, and 2x2) have been proposed over time.
